Thoughtful Classroom Principal Effectiveness Framework Now Available for SuperEval Users

January 21st, 2020

Rubric conceptSuperEval, in partnership with Silver Strong & Associates, is pleased to announce the addition of the Thoughtful Classroom Principal Effectiveness Framework to its online evaluation system. Now, education leaders have access to another high-quality evaluation rubric to evaluate building-level principals that is approved for the Annual Professional Performance Review (APPR) by the New York State Department of Education.

SuperEval is the only online evaluation system for school leaders and focuses on strengthening teams through self-reflection, deeper conversations, and continuous growth.

“We are thrilled to announce our new partnership with Silver Strong & Associates!” said Michael Horning, Jr., Executive Vice President of SuperEval. “Adding another high-quality evaluation rubric allows for more principals to participate in our unique SuperEval evaluation process. This process allows a principal to self-assess through engaging in reflective leadership practices while assembling an evidence portfolio. This transcends evaluation from an act of compliance to leadership development and professional growth.”

SuperEval offers a menu of standardized rubrics for school boards, superintendents, principals and assistant principals, central office administrators, building level administrators, school business officials, and support staff.

Dr. Harvey Silver, cofounder and president of Silver Strong & Associates, said, “We learned about SuperEval through our PD partnerships with schools across the country. So many school leaders were telling us about the power and simplicity of SuperEval. When we looked at SuperEval more closely, we recognized that it would be an ideal tool for making our Thoughtful Classroom Principal Effectiveness Framework come to life in schools. We are excited to be able to offer this high-impact evaluation and growth tool to our school partners.”

The Thoughtful Classroom Principal Effectiveness Framework is currently available to use in SuperEval for school leaders in all 50 states.

About Silver Strong & Associates:

Founded in 1974 by Dr. Harvey F. Silver and the late Richard W. Strong, Silver Strong & Associates (SSA) is an educational consulting and publishing company that provides custom professional development and practical resources to schools and districts throughout the country.

For nearly 40 years, SSA has partnered with hundreds of schools, districts, and state education organizations throughout the United States and Canada to provide high-quality professional development for teachers, administrators, and school leaders. The organization has extensive experience working with schools in urban, suburban, and rural communities to meet the needs of diverse learners. During these years, SSA has successfully executed over 3200 professional development contracts (including many multi-year partnerships) and has built an exceptional staff of professionals who provide support in all areas necessary for developing and implementing customized professional development programs for multiple school districts nationwide.
